Summary
Diet-induced carotenemia in women with amenorrhea may contribute to hypothalamic hypogonadotropic anovulation (HHA). Diet modification reduced carotene levels and improved menstrual function, suggesting a link between carotenemia and menstrual disorders.
Area of Science:
- Endocrinology
- Nutrition Science
- Reproductive Health
Background:
- Carotenemia, characterized by yellow-orange skin discoloration, is often associated with amenorrhea.
- Traditional causes include significant weight loss or anorexia nervosa.
- This study investigates a potential dietary etiology in women with menstrual dysfunction.
Purpose of the Study:
- To explore the relationship between carotenemia and menstrual disorders in women.
- To identify dietary factors contributing to carotenemia in patients with anovulation and amenorrhea.
- To assess the impact of dietary modifications on both carotene levels and menstrual function.
Main Methods:
- Clinical and laboratory data were collected from ten women presenting with anovulation and associated carotenemia.
- Dietary habits were assessed, focusing on the consumption of vegetarian or predominantly vegetarian diets.
- Treatment involved diet modification, and outcomes were monitored for changes in carotene levels and menstrual status.
Main Results:
- Nine of the ten women experienced amenorrhea alongside carotenemia.
- Carotenemia was found to be diet-induced, linked to high intake of carotene-rich foods in predominantly vegetarian diets.
- Diet modification resulted in decreased serum carotene levels and restoration of menstrual cycles in affected patients.
Conclusions:
- Diet-induced carotenemia may be a contributing factor to hypothalamic hypogonadotropic anovulation (HHA).
- Dietary adjustments can effectively manage carotenemia and improve menstrual irregularities.
- Further research is warranted to elucidate the precise mechanisms linking carotenemia to the development of HHA.
